    Purchased this Muscle-KIK product for inside my house so I could work out in air conditioner rather than the summer Arizona Heat in the Garage. I looked at several products including what my Physical Therapist office was using and this appeared to be the best solution.Available in just one (1) rail or two (2) rails, available in a brushed chrome or brushed black color, I went with the two (2) 40 inch rails in black due to my room. Installation was easy but caution must be exercised to insure that you are fastening five (5) each fasteners into the center of a stud, preferably in a load bearing wall rather than a partition wall.The height of installation of one (1) or both rails is user preference based on their height what they plan tyo attach to the rail and how it is used. The same goes with the hook orientation, up or down. In my case, at 6' tall, I set mine up mostly for the waist and shoulder exercises along with my TRX system.One complaint however, which can be a product improvement by the manufacturer or purchase if you have the right drill press and drill buts is that you can not butt both rails up together because the end rail fastener through holes are not counter sunk like the rest of them, This prohibits the ability to move the hooks from one rail to another.. So you musty currently use the end cap as shown until modified.After you have decided on the mounting location, use a marker of some kind to mark the hole locations for your fasteners. Is used an 1/8" drill bit for pilot holes. I would not use larger or smaller than 3/64" diameter drill bit because too much torch on the screw head could snap the head of the screw off. So use a low torque driver to install the fasteners.Enjoy....In additional thing you might need is a seperate single loop strap to attach to the hooks with an end that will accept carabiners if you are using some attachments for additional security.

    Well-Designed, well-made, & thoughtfully-packaged: We purchased one pair of these Muscle Kik Wall Anchor Systems for use with our TRX Grip It & Heavy-Duty Resistance Bands, and I can't even begin to tell you how impressed we are. Material & Construction quality appears to be top-notch. Mounting accessories (screws, etc.) are the same. Even the packaging was impressive, with the mounting hardware being stored in a heavy-gauge zipped bag (as opposed to the typical flimsy plastic seen from all others that inevitably bursts in transit). Thanks to the massive amount of adjustability, one set of Muscle-Kik Mounts with a good set of high-quality resistance bands (and maybe a suspension trainer!) is more than enough for most folks' use. Thanks to the quality, I could see potential uses in an office, home, or gym as these are a great foundation for functional strength training, physical therapy, & core engagement during interval training (via bands/suspension equipment purchased separately).The low ceiling in our basement prevented us from installing a full-size dual cable-cross/Free Motion machine (which--by the way--typically go for $5k-$12k), but three sets of these (two shoulder-to-elbow-width and a third for wide resistance in exercises like a chest fly) combined with high quality resistance bands entirely replaced the need for bulky equipment at <10% of the total cost. Added benefit: 100% of the floor space is maintained by getting rid of the larger weight equipment.Top tips: Be sure you are mounting these correctly (into the studs!) as you will only be as safe as your mounting. Also: if you are mounting using alternative hardware not provided by the seller, be sure to check the actual strength specifications of the hardware in your specific mounting surface. Typical Tapcon Masonry screws--for example--only offer a max 220 lb pull-out resistance when correctly mounted in lightweight CMU construction (and typically you don't want to exert force on a screw that is anything close to its maximum).I especially appreciated the note in the packaging requesting an "honest review" and stating that you are a family-owned business.
